There was knocking.
Leto felt like she had just gotten to sleep an hour ago, and there was knocking. She rolled over in bed to look at the clock and frowned. Shifting again, she looked over at Levon, who had been sleeping with her. Mercifully, he was still asleep. Leto smoothed the hair on his forehead before climbing out of bed, and hurrying out of the bedroom. Once she made her way to the door, she threw it open. She did not expect to see Genny, looking very awake, wide-eyed, and very nervous.
"Genny? Do you know what time it is?" Leto asked, sort of wanting to strangle the girl. She'd worried that it was Alex.
"We have a problem." Genny answered.
Leto had a problem alright, in the form of a little redhead girl waking her up, but she kept that to herself. She didn't say anything, just crossed her arms over her chest and waited, half slumping against her door frame.
"All of the medical staff is gone." Genny said. "All of them. Dr. Taylor... everyone. No one is left."
...Okay, Leto felt a bit more awake now. Or perhaps she was still asleep and dreaming. She stood a little bit straighter. "What are you talking about? Where did they go?"
"I don't know!" Genny answered. "A lot more, too. They just disappeared. We can't find them." she explained. "What do you want to do?"
Leto was attempting to process, which was not an easy task. In fact, she felt absolutely certain that her brain was broken, and, and... wait, what did she say? Leto tilted her head to the side and stared at Genny. "What do I want to... huh? What are you talking about?"
"Well you're in charge now!" Genny answered, holding out a clipboard. "There are still people that need help. You have to do it!"
Okay, now her brain was broken. She sputtered on words, feeling like she'd forgotten each and every language she knew. "I'm a nurse!" she blurted out. "I can't... you can't... it doesn't work that way! I wouldn't even know where to start!"
"I'll help you!" Genny said. "I found Dr. Taylor's keys, and I've checked some of his files already..."
Leto backed up, feeling on the verge of an honest to God panic attack. She hadn't felt so horrified in a long time. She kept backing up until the back of her leg hit the sofa, and she sat down. Just breathe. It's going to be okay. Whatever happened to them, it hasn't happened to you. Levon's still here. But with that thought came the terrifying need to check on her father and Alex. But she didn't feel like her legs would work.
"Um... there is one problem." Genny said, taking a step forward and letting the door fall closed.
One problem. One problem?! Leto stared up at Genny with a shocked look on her face, her brain absolutely flooded with problems. Problems, in the heavily fucking plural! Couldn't Genny see she was having a moment here?! She was still trying to deal with her own problems!
Genny took another step, and held out a file. "I found that in Dr. Taylor's notes."
Leto stared at the extended file, quite sure that she didn't want to know. But after a moment of staring at it, she finally took it, and with a heavy heart, opened the file to read. Her shoulders felt heavier and heavier with every word.
Now it was real. Now she was involved. And all she wanted to do was run in the opposite direction. She continued to stare at the words on the page for a long time before accepting it. "Where do we start?"
